Output 66e80b1f60478da0f892aa2c66b896856e17c3d069fd563581bf6f36858556d3:1

value
1133000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ada0325e39d7bce757fea2aa49b784a9744372d OP_EQUAL
address
3BRzidwZM1AavugxZ8HdC25XvSwMCS9S4H
transaction
66e80b1f60478da0f892aa2c66b896856e17c3d069fd563581bf6f36858556d3
spent
true